Cespedes was been placed on the 10-day disabled list Friday with a strained left hamstring, Jon Heyman of FanRag Sports reports.
The news doesn't come as a major surprise after Cespedes came up gimpy in Thursday's game and only adds another layer to an injury-plagued 2017 campaign for the 31-year-old. After just recently returning to the starting lineup, it appears the Mets' main source of offense will miss extended time, meaning Michael Conforto and Juan Lagares will be in line for a wider share of opportunities in the outfield. Look for Cespedes to return to his normal power-hitting form once he gets back to full health.
